Transaction 08fc8c07b76d950425beeb47352fcff029b269c68902a62a31a14dd437334560
1 Input
1 Output
-
08fc8c07b76d950425beeb47352fcff029b269c68902a62a31a14dd437334560:0
- value
- 24915397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0da6dedf59ad904a3aaf2f1a96c1d17bf3209106 OP_EQUAL
- address
- 32wCcQintGPTGfMUT979qPPYDRU33ZNDv8